Position

Christian Wenger specializes in commercial and business law with focus on private equity, venture capital and mergers & acquisitions. He primarily represents institutional investors, corporates and entrepreneurs in the context of financing rounds and acquisitions.

He serves as chairman and member of various boards of directors of Swiss as well as international companies. Christian Wenger was a member of the Executive Committee of SECA (Swiss Private Equity & Corporate Finance Association) for a number of years and headed the “Venture Capital and Seed” chapter. In this capacity, he has been involved on a pro bono basis in various federal and cantonal projects to promote young entrepreneurship and Switzerland as a technology location.

In 2003, he founded Swiss Startup Invest (formerly CTI Invest), the largest investor platform for growth companies in Switzerland. Christian Wenger initiated the Startup Days, an annual event for over 400 startups. He has been the president of this association since its inception.

In 2011, he launched the Blue Lion incubator for start-ups in the ICT and cleantech sector together with the City of Zurich, Zürcher Kantonalbank, Swisscom AG, the University of Zurich and ETH.

In 2015, Christian Wenger founded the digitalswitzerland movement with further 17 companies, universities and corporations with the aim of positioning Switzerland as a leading technology nation across Europe. He leads and presides over the Executive Committee of this Association.

In spring of 2017, Christian Wenger was elected to the Board of Trustees of the UZH Foundation of the University of Zurich.

Christian Wenger graduated from the University of Zurich and gained his doctorate on the subject “Das bedingte Kapital” [Contingent Capital]. He completed his academic career with a postgraduate degree from Duke University Law School, North Carolina (LL.M.).
